Apple's mixed reality headset said to support Wi-Fi 6E connectivity

Concept render by Antonio De Rosa. <br>Image source: Antonio De Rosa

Apple's upcoming mixed reality headset is rumoured to support Wi-Fi 6E connectivity.

Analyst Ming-Chi Kuo wrote in his latest investor note that the faster Wi-Fi 6E connectivity is important in delivering a high-end, immersive experience. Kuo says new headsets from Meta and Sony will adopt Wi-Fi 6/6E next year. Wi-Fi 6E boasts higher performance, lower latency, and faster data rates in the 6GHz band, which provides higher bandwidth and less interferences.

Mark Gurman from Bloomberg shared yesterday that the mixed reality headset will have both AR and VR capabilities to deliver "a mixed reality experience that can handle games in high-quality virtual reality". However, The Information claims that the headset needs to be tethered to an iPhone to maximise its functionality.
